A widely circulated developer essay argues small models have become good enough for real products, while new work on binarized network pruning and multi-drafter speculative decoding attacks the cost from both ends.

An essay titled "Small Models Have Arrived" reached the top of Hacker News this week, arguing that models small enough to run locally now meet the quality threshold for a large class of production tasks, and that the practical constraint on…
